Fuel Pressure 502mpi will not got above 30psi
Ive almost had it.. I have an old style (fresh) 502 VST style MPI Ive changed both fuel pumps, had all my injectors done, new regulator.. basically new fuel system. and still cant get my fuel pressure above 30psi.
(I believe it should be in the 32-34 range) Does anybody have any suggestions I'm about to go crazy with this one..
It almost feels like its a voltage issue. If the pumps are not getting proper volts would the fuel pressure be lower then its supposed to be?? Does this make sense? Ive been working on this for so long I'm starting to loose my clarity....Thanks for any help or suggestions in advance.. MW

Re: Fuel Pressure MPI will not got above 30psi
Most definitely if your pump doesn't have full voltage you will not reach proper fuel pressure. You did say you checked your regulator, so that would of been the first place to look. A clogged fuel filter/separator can also cause low pressure.
